基于多特征的空域替换类图像隐写检测方法

摘要: 提出一种基于多特征的空域替换类图像隐写检测方法。通过分析空域替换隐写原理,找出空域替换类隐写的共性,分别用位平面纹理相似性和位平面统计相关性以及位平面低比特位随机性来度量和刻画该类隐写对图像位平面间关系属性以及图像位平面属性的影响,由此构建针对空域替换类的隐写检测方法。实验结果表明该方法有效,并具有较高的检测准确性和较强的适应性。

Abstract: This paper presents a detection method for image spatial replacement steganography based on multi-feature. By analyzing the principle of spatial replacement embedding, the commonness is found. Texture similarity and statistical relativity of bit plane are used to measure and describe the impact on the relationship of image bit planes caused by such embedding, and the randomicity of the least significant bit plane is used to measure and describe the effect that embedding has upon the bit planes’ attribute, and the detection method for spatial replacement embedding is modeled. Experiment shows that the method is of high detection accuracy and robust adaptability.
